REWRITING DEVICE FOR ERASABLE PROGRAMMABLE READ ONLY MEMORY

    Abstract: PURPOSE:To rewrite stored contents with an erasable programmable read only memory EPROM set by directly setting a rewrite adapter, which is connected to an EPROM rewriting device main body by a cable, to the EPROM set to a package. CONSTITUTION:An adapter 2 for EPROM rewrite is attached to an EPROM 3 set to a package 6. The adapter 2 is connected to an EPROM rewriting device main body 1 by a cable 5, and stored contents of the EPROM 3 are irradiated with ultraviolet rays from a lamp incorporated in the adapter and are erased in accordance with the instruction from the device main body 1. Information which is read from a master ROM and is stored in a memory provided in the EPROM rewriting device main body 1 is sent to the adapter 2 from an incorporated ROM writer and is written in the EPROM 3. Thus, stored contents are updated with the EPROM 3 set to the package 6.

    PORTABLE TERMINAL EQUIPMENT

    Abstract: PURPOSE:To omit the use of the connection cables and the connectors by adding an optical input device part into the main body of a terminal equipment. CONSTITUTION:An optical input part (an automatic bar code scanner) 2 is set into a lower part of a terminal equipment main body 1 to read the bar codes. At the same time, a keyboard input part 3 and a data display part 4 are set into the upper parts of the main body 1. The part 2 is applied onto a bar code 5. The bar code 5 is read and at the same time the necessary information are inputted to the main body 1 with push of the keys of the part 3 for collection of information. Then the input information is shown at the part 4. Thus no connector nor a connection cable is required for connection of an optical input device since the part 2 is contained in the main body 1.

    LOW NOISE FAN

    Abstract: PURPOSE:To decrease hissing sounds by wind effectively by collecting the hissing sounds from a low noise fan and providing a converting circuit for regenerating sounds of opposite phase to that of these sounds by a speaker. CONSTITUTION:A low noise fan 1 is provided with a microphone 3 which can collect the hissing sounds caused each blade of blades 2. The hissing sound by wind inputted from this microphone 3 is converted to an electric signal in A/D converting circuit 4. This electric signal is transmitted to a first Fourier converting circuit 5, a memory circuit 6, a second Fourier converting circuit 7 and D/A converting circuit 8. The output of D/A converting circuit 8 is regen erated as a sound in a speaker 9. Based on the nature of Fourier conversion, the frequency phase of the sound regenerated by speaker 9 is shifted by 180 deg. from that of the sound inputted from the microphone 3. Thereby, the hissing sound by wind air can be eliminated.

    FINGERPRINT PICTURE INPUT DEVICE

    Abstract: PURPOSE:To obtain a fingerprint picture with good picture quality and large detection area and without any graphic distortion by providing a tandem transparent electrode on the surface of a curved glass and detecting automatically the fingerprint picture of a finger when the finger is placed on it and sweats. CONSTITUTION:The title device has a curved glass 11 curved so that its inner surface and outer surface may be concentric cylindrical shapes and further, provided inside with a transparent electrode 17 faced to plural tandems and a driving means 4 to fix respectively a one-dimensional sensor 12 equipped with an image forming system fixed so as to focus on the inner surface of the curved glass 11 and a lighting means 13 so as to satisfy all reflection conditions to the inner surfaces of the curved glass 11, to rotatively drive a main scanning mechanism 14 as keeping the conditions and to execute the sub scanning of the one-dimensional image sensor 12 along the outer circumference of the curved glass 11. The tandem transparent electrode 17 is used, that the finger is placed is detected and the driving means 4 is operated. Since it is not until the finger touches and sweats surely that a scanning start signal (a) is obtained, the quality of the obtained picture signal (a) is extremely good and not only the detection area is large but also the graphic distortion becomes small.

    FINGERPRINT IMAGE INPUT DEVICE

    Abstract: PURPOSE:To detect a fingerprint image having a wide detected area and no graphic distortion by detecting the fingerprint image of a finger pressed on the curved surface of a curved glass body. CONSTITUTION:A one-dimensionally arranged optical fiber lens 1-6 is equipped and an image sensor 1-2 and an illuminator 1-3 are fixed in the positional relation to satisfy all reflective conditions at the internal surface of a curved glass body 1-1. The image sensor 1-2 detects and outputs the image on the internal surface of the curved glass body 1-1 by the optical fiber lens 1-6. The principle of detection is that the difference of the intensity of the light reflected from a part touched by a skin and a part untouched is converted into an electrical signal and detected by the image sensor 1-2. When a pulse motor 1-4 revolves, the image sensor 1-2 and the illuminator 1-3, while keeping all reflective conditions to the internal surface of the curved glass body 1-1, moves along the external surface periphery of the curved glass body 1-1. Thus, the fingerprint image of the finger can be automatically detected.

    BATTERY PACK WITH RESIDUAL CAPACITY DISPLAY

    Abstract: PURPOSE:To prevent a damage by an overcharge and an overdischarge of a battery by adding and reducing the charging current and the discharging current to a secondary battery accumulatively at every specific time, and displaying the resultant residual capacity, in a battery pack with built-in secondary battery. CONSTITUTION:An A/D converter 3 outputs a binary number with mark, and the output is input to one side input terminal of a computing element 4, and the other side terminal of the computing element 4 is connected to a register 5 to store the operation result. The converting timing of the converter 3 and the storing timing to the register 5 are synchronized by a timer 6. And the value proportional to the charged power amount in the charging time is accumulated, while the value proportional to the value subtracting the discharge amount from the accumulated amount remains, in the register 5. The output of the register 5 is input to a display 7, where it is displayed as the battery residual capacity.

    COUNTING CIRCUIT FOR RESIDUAL QUANTITY OF CHARGE OF SECONDARY BATTERY

    Abstract: PURPOSE:To inform the calculated charge residual quantity of a secondary battery to a user. CONSTITUTION:A current is converted to voltage drop quantity by a resistor element 3 and this voltage drop quantity is converted to a digital value by a voltage amplifier 4 and an A/D converter 5. This digital value is sampled at every unit time. The standard value being the product of the current of the secondary battery and a current supply time is stored in a read exclusion memory 8 so as to become the initial value at the time of operation and the initial value read from the read exclusive memory 8 and the above mentioned digital value are repeatedly subjected to subtraction processing by an operation circuit 11 to calculate charge residual quantity and the charge residual quantity value is displayed on a display part 18.

    BATTERY CHARGER PACK

    Abstract: PURPOSE:To ensure the easy control of a battery by automatically indicating a charge frequency on a battery charger pack. CONSTITUTION:The polarity of a voltage drop generated across a micro resistor 2 is reversed between charge and discharge processes. Voltage across the micro resistor 2 is inputted to a comparator 3, and output therefrom turns into a pulse signal reversing every time the polarity of the voltage drop changes. The output from the aforesaid comparator 3 is inputted to a counter 4, and counted. Then, output from the counter 4, or a charge frequency is always displayed as a value with a display 5.
